Starting Point: From the Buda Castle to Fisherman’s Bastion

Private Buda Castle Walking Tour with Cake and Matthias Church - Starting Point: From the Buda Castle to Fisherman’s Bastion

This tour begins at Buda Castle, the regal landmark perched high above the Danube. Your guide leads you through the castle’s courtyards and halls, sharing the history behind its architecture, which includes remains of various former castles, some still under reconstruction. With skip-the-line access, you avoid long queues, making the most of your limited time here.

Following the castle exploration, the tour moves to Matthias Church. This medieval church is renowned for its stunning architecture and historical significance. The 30-minute visit allows ample time to admire its colorful tiled roof, intricate interior, and the stories behind its centuries-old construction.

Next, the guide takes you past Fisherman’s Bastion, a fairy-tale-like structure offering panoramic views of Budapest. The 15-minute pass-by offers photo opportunities and a quick look at its ornate terraces, without the need for a lengthy stop.
